Hello hunters & makers! Happy to share my first post on ProductHunt. Brain is a AI driven product that automatically aggregates, curates & summarises news for you. As a millennial like me, I've got 2 pain points that encouraged me to build this product. 1.) I want to read the news as fast as possible and I tend to be turned-off when I see long articles. [I've built a summariser engine] 2.) If I find an article that sparks my interest, I tend to google more about the background of that particular story. [I've incorporated Brainlet] That's how I started to develop Brain. 😉 You can find it on this article on how it satisfies my 2 pain points: https://brain.sg/article/trump-s...
